Maverick Donuts

What Is Web Scraping And What Is It Used For?


Web Scraping

The internet scraper claims to crawl 600,000+ domains and is utilized by big players like MailChimp and PayPal. CloudScrape also supports nameless knowledge access by offering a set of proxy servers to hide your identity. CloudScrape stores your data on its servers for two weeks before archiving it. The web scraper offers 20 scraping hours at no cost and will value $29 per 30 days. Using an online scraping tool, one also can obtain solutions for offline reading or storage by accumulating data from multiple sites (including StackOverflow and extra Q&A websites).
Or the webserver denies a submitted type that sounds perfectly fine. Or even worse, your IP gets blocked by a website for anonymous causes. For this function, there’s an awesome software known as PhantomJS that loads your page and runs your code with out opening any browsers.

Web Scraper utilizes a modular structure that is manufactured from selectors, which instructs the scraper on the way to traverse the target web site and what knowledge to extract. Thanks to this structure, Web Scraper is able to extract data from trendy and dynamic websites similar to Amazon, Tripadvisor, eBay, and so forth, in addition to from smaller, lesser-identified web sites.

Why Is Python Good For Web Scraping?



You can hire a developer to build customized data extraction software on your specific requirement. The developer can in-flip make use of net scraping APIs which helps him/her develop the software program simply. For example apify.com lets you easily get APIs to scrape knowledge from any website. First, which may be domestically installed in your computer and second, which runs in cloud – browser based. A internet scraping software will automatically load and extract knowledge from multiple pages of internet sites based mostly on your requirement.
With our superior internet scraper, extracting information is as straightforward as clicking on the info you want. First, our team of seasoned scraping veterans develops a scraper unique to your project, designed particularly to target and extract the info you need from the web sites you want it from. This advanced web scraper allows extracting data is as easy as clicking the information you want.
Web scraping software program may access the World Wide Web directly using the Hypertext Transfer Protocol, or via an online browser. While net scraping can be accomplished manually by a software consumer, the time period usually refers to automated processes applied utilizing a bot or web crawler.
Web Scraping
Web Scraper runs in your browser and does not something require to be installed on your pc. You don’t need any Python, PHP, or JavaScript coding experience to start scraping with Web Scraper. Additionally, Web Scraper presents you the ability to utterly automate data extraction in Web Scraper Cloud.
One of the important strategies of fixing lots of scraping points is dealing with cookies accurately. Websites that are using cookies to trace your progress by way of the positioning may also use cookies to stop scrapers with abnormal habits and stop them from scraping the web site.
There are quite a lot of tutorials to get you started with the basics and then progress on to more advanced extraction projects. It’s additionally simple to start on the free plan and then migrate up to the Standard and Professional plans as required. This also permits for very simple integration of advanced features corresponding to IP rotation, which can stop your scraper from getting blocked from main web sites because of their scraping activity. Then the scraper will either extract all the info on the page or particular knowledge chosen by the user earlier than the project is run. First, the online scraper might be given one or more URLs to load earlier than scraping.
Web Scraping
Web Scraping is the brand new data entry technique that don’t require repetitive typing or copy-pasting. Octoparse is an extremely powerful information extraction software that has optimized and pushed our data captcha solving services and available captcha types scraping efforts to the next degree. Run your personal JavaScript code in browser before extracting information.
It permits you to obtain your scraped knowledge in any format for analysis. There are many software program instruments available that can be utilized to customize net-scraping solutions. Some internet scraping software program can also be used to extract information from an API directly. Web scraping, web harvesting, or internet data extraction is knowledge scraping used for extracting knowledge from websites.
It is both customized constructed for a selected web site or is one which may be configured to work with any website. With the clicking of a button you can simply save the information out there in the website to a file in your laptop.
Web Scraping
This reduces dependence on energetic Internet connections because the assets are readily available regardless of the supply of Internet entry. There are several methods to extract information from the net. Use ofAPIs being most likely one of the simplest ways to extract knowledge from an internet site.
Web Scraping
In this article onWeb Scraping with Python, you will study net scraping in brief and see how to extract data from a web site with an illustration. As a facet notice, I strongly suggest saving the scraped dataset before exiting your notebook kernel. This means you’ll only need to import the dataset whenever you resume working, and don’t have to run the scraping script again. This becomes extremely useful when you scrape tons of or hundreds of internet pages.
FMiner is one other in style software for internet scraping, knowledge extraction, crawling display scraping, macro, and internet help for Window and Mac OS. Diffbot allows you to get numerous sort of helpful knowledge from the web without the effort. You needn’t pay the expense of expensive internet scraping or doing handbook research.

Do share your story with us using the feedback part below. These software program search for new data manually or automatically, fetching the brand new or up to date knowledge and storing them on your easy access.
The primary challenge for the websites that are exhausting to scrape is that they are already can determine how to differentiate between actual humans and scrapers in varied ways like using CAPTCHAS. The most disappointing thing whereas scraping a web site is the info not seen throughout viewing the output even it’s visible within the browser.
We also keep away from disrupting the activity of the web site we scrape by permitting the server to answer different users’ requests too. If you navigate via those pages and observe the URL, you will notice that only the values of the parameters change. This means we will write a script to match the logic of the modifications and make far fewer requests to scrape our data. One approach to get all the data we’d like is to compile a listing of film names, and use it to entry the net web page of every film on each IMDB and Metacritic web sites. It’s essential to establish the objective of our scraping proper from the beginning.
You want ten completely different guidelines (XPath, CSS selectors…) to deal with the different cases. Web scraping instruments are used to extract data from the internet. Here is our list of the highest 20 best web scraping tools for 2020. ParseHub is an intuitive and easy to be taught data scraping software.
For instance, one might acquire info about merchandise and their costs from Amazon using a scraping device. In this publish, we’re itemizing the use circumstances of net scraping tools and the top 10 internet scraping tools to gather information, with zero coding. Web Scraping instruments are particularly developed for extracting info from websites. 5 tips for sending effective business emails are also known as internet harvesting instruments or internet knowledge extraction tools. These instruments are helpful for anyone attempting to collect some type of knowledge from the Internet.
With scraping, extracting the information will take a fraction of that time. If a browser can render a page, and we will parse the HTML in a structured way, it’s protected to say we can carry out internet scraping to entry all the data. Web scraping is the act of pulling knowledge immediately from an internet site by parsing the HTML from the online page itself. It refers to retrieving or “scraping” information from a website. Instead of going through the difficult means of bodily extracting knowledge, internet scraping employs slicing-edge automation to retrieve numerous data points from any number of websites.
We selected a warning over breaking the loop because there’s an excellent risk we’ll scrape enough knowledge, even when a number of the requests fail. We will only break the loop if the number of requests is bigger than expected. Given that we’re scraping 72 pages, it might be nice if we may discover a way to monitor the scraping course of as it’s nonetheless going.
This characteristic is certainly elective, however it can be very helpful within the testing and debugging process. Also, the larger the number of pages, the extra helpful the monitoring becomes. If you’ll scrape hundreds or 1000’s of web pages in a single code run, I would say that this feature turns into a must. Controlling the rate of crawling is useful for us, and for the website we’re scraping. If we avoid hammering the server with tens of requests per second, then we are a lot less prone to get our IP handle banned.
Writing a scraping script can take lots of time, particularly if we need to scrape more than one net page. We want to avoid spending hours writing a script which scrapes data we received’t really want. Scraper is a Chrome extension with limited data extraction features nevertheless it’s helpful for making online analysis, and exporting data to Google Spreadsheets. This tool is meant for beginners in addition to specialists who can easily copy knowledge to the clipboard or retailer to the spreadsheets utilizing OAuth.

Web scraping is an automatic methodology used to extract massive quantities of knowledge from web sites. Web scraping helps gather these unstructured information and retailer it in a structured kind. There are different ways to scrape websites corresponding to on-line Services, APIs or writing your individual code. In this text, we’ll see the way to implement web scraping with python.
If the annotations are embedded within the pages, as Microformat does, this technique could be viewed as a special case of DOM parsing. This tutorial will educate you varied ideas of internet scraping and makes you snug with scraping various forms of websites and their information.

Excel Vba Web Scraping



We either login to the website we want or we can simply instantly choose the supply website hyperlink from where we need to copy the info. In a standard method, if we need to copy any information from any web site, we first open the website, copy the data, and paste it in Excel file. But now we’ll use the Excel VBA Web Scraping code to fetch the information from the website we wish with out even opening it. 80legs is a robust but versatile internet crawling software that can be configured to your wants. It helps fetching big quantities of information along with the option to obtain the extracted information instantly.
  • Web scraping is an automated technique used to extract massive quantities of knowledge from websites.
  • There are alternative ways to scrape web sites such as on-line Services, APIs or writing your individual code.
  • Web scraping helps acquire these unstructured knowledge and retailer it in a structured kind.
  • In this article, we’ll see tips on how to implement web scraping with python.

Meaning not only you can scrape information from exterior websites, but you may also rework the information, use exterior APIs (like Clearbit, Google Sheets…). Developing in-home net scrapers is painful because web sites are constantly changing.
The scraper then masses the entire HTML code for the web page in question. More superior scrapers will render the complete web site, together with CSS and Javascript elements.

Web scraper is a chrome extension which helps you for the net scraping and information acquisition. It permits you to scape multiple pages and provides dynamic knowledge extraction capabilities. Web scraping instruments are specifically developed software for extracting helpful information from the websites. These instruments are helpful for anyone who is looking to collect some type of information from the Internet. Web scraping an online page involves fetching it and extracting from it.
Web scraping typically is the process of extracting knowledge from the online; you’ll be able to analyze the data and extract helpful data. In this tutorial, we’ll speak about Python net scraping and the way to scrape net pages using multiple libraries similar to Beautiful Soup, Selenium, and another magic tools like PhantomJS. See how easy it’s for us to scrape information using rvest, while we have been writing 10+ traces of code in much simpler scraping situations. Well, I’ll be leaping a couple of steps ahead and can show you a preview of rvest bundle whereas scraping this page.
This can be used to interact with web page components, modify DOM or invoke JavaScript functions already applied in goal web page. To scrape anonymously and to prevent the online scraping software program from being blocked by internet servers, you have the option to access target web sites via proxy servers or VPN. Either a single proxy server address or a list of proxy server addresses may be used. Often web sites show knowledge corresponding to product listings or search leads to multiple pages.
Web scraping, additionally referred to as internet data mining or net harvesting, is the method of constructing an agent which might extract, parse, obtain and arrange helpful information from the net mechanically. Chrome Inspector Panel is a device to view a real POST request sent to the web site to make sure that a human request seems the same because the one your scraper is trying everything you need to know about lead generation to send. Now, if the shape is populated with information, then there’s a massive likelihood that it was carried out by an internet scraper, and the despatched kind shall be blocked. In this case, any hidden subject with actual worth or worth that is totally different from anticipated could also be neglected, and the user could even be banned from the website.

Scraping Javascript


As shown in the video above, WebHarvy is a point and click internet scraper which helps you to scrape information from web sites with ease. Unlike most other net scraper software, WebHarvy may be configured to extract the required information from websites with mouse clicks. You simply need to select the info to be extracted by pointing the mouse. We recommend that you attempt the evaluation model of WebHarvy or see the video demo.
The software will enable you to actual structured knowledge from any URL with AI extractors. QVC’s complaint alleges that the defendant disguised its web crawler to masks its supply IP tackle and thus prevented QVC from rapidly repairing the problem. This is a very attention-grabbing scraping case as a result of QVC is in search of damages for the unavailability of their website, which QVC claims was brought on by Resultly. The pages being scraped could embrace metadata or semantic markups and annotations, which can be utilized to find particular data snippets.
Setting up your projects has a bit of a studying curve, but that’s a small funding for the way highly effective their service is. It’s the right software for non-technical individuals looking to extract information, whether or not that is for a small one-off project, or an enterprise kind scrape working each hour. The open internet is by far the best world repository for human information, there may be virtually no information you could’t find through extracting web knowledge. A net scraper is a specialised software designed to accurately and rapidly extract information from an online page. Web scrapers range broadly in design and complexity, relying on the project.

Scrapinghub


Web scraping is a pc software program strategy of extracting data from websites. This technique mostly focuses on the transformation of unstructured knowledge on the web into structured information . Our aim is to make internet data extraction so simple as potential. Configure scraper by merely pointing and clicking on parts. One of probably the most intestering options is that they offer built-in data flows.

First, we need to undergo different scraping conditions that you simply’ll frequently encounter whenever you scrape information via R. There are the completely different processes of Web Scraping through which we will directly set up the tool and add-ins into the browser which would assist in fetching up the information from any URL.

It is a form of copying, in which particular knowledge is gathered and copied from the online, usually into a central local database or spreadsheet, for later retrieval or evaluation. Web types that are dealing with account logins and creation show a excessive threat to safety if they’re a straightforward target for casual scraping.

Web Scraping in Excel or in any device is used to fetch the info from any web site using the Internet Explorer browser mainly. We can copy the information from any web site and paste it in the cell the place we wish to see the information.
Or we will create a process by which we get the data of any website in any kind. For this, we may need to login to the website if it requires.
This is because if you are getting access to structured data from the provider, why would you want to create an engine to extract the same information. Build scrapers, scrape sites and export information in CSV format instantly from your browser. Use Web Scraper Cloud to export knowledge in CSV, XLSX and JSON codecs, access it via API, webhooks or get it exported via Dropbox. ParseHub has been a dependable and constant net scraper for us for practically two years now.

Best Web Scraping Tools For 2020


Therefore, net crawling is a primary part of net scraping, to fetch pages for later processing. The content material of a web page may be parsed, searched, reformatted, its information copied right into a spreadsheet, and so forth.
When you run the code for web scraping, a request is distributed to the URL that you’ve got talked about. As a response to the request, the server sends the data and permits you to learn the HTML or XML page. The code then, parses the HTML or XML page, finds the data and extracts it.

Simplescraper Io


So, for a lot of website homeowners, they can use these forms to restrict scraper access to their websites. The first step in the direction of scraping the web with R requires you to understand HTML and web scraping fundamentals. You’ll discover ways to get browsers to show the supply code, then you will develop the logic of markup languages which sets you on the trail to scrape that information. And, above all – you’ll grasp the vocabulary you need to scrape data with R. We all have heard of the scraping course of but we have by no means come throughout it.

Web scrapers typically take one thing out of a web page, to utilize it for one more objective some place else. An example would be to seek out and duplicate names and cellphone numbers, or firms and their URLs, to a list .

WebHarvy can routinely crawl and extract knowledge from multiple pages. Just point out the ‘hyperlink to load the following web page’ and WebHarvy Web Scraper will mechanically scrape data from all pages. You can save the data extracted from websites in a wide range of formats. The present model of WebHarvy Web Scraping Software lets you save the extracted data as an Excel, XML, CSV, JSON or TSV file. If you need to gather these SWIFT codes for an inside project, it will take hours to repeat it manually.

About The Author




Ekaterina Mironova


Author Biograhy: Ekaterina Mironova is a co-founder of CBD Life Mag and an avid blogger on the Hemp, CBD and fashion subjects. Ekaterina is also on the panel of the CBD reviewers and she most enjoys CBD gummies. Ekaterina has developed a real interest in CBD products after she started taking CBD tincture oil to help her ease her anxiety that was part-and-parcel of her quick-paced city career. When Ekaterina realised just how effective CBD is, she has founded CBD Life Magazine along with some of her friends.

When she is not blogging, you are likely to see Ekaterina in front of her souped up Alienware laptop gaming or delving into the world of Cryptocurrency. Ekaterina also boasts a very large collection of Penny Black Posts stamps and silver hammered Medieval coins. Ekaterina’s other interest include swimming, painting, traveling, shopping, spending a good time with her friends and helping animals in need.

Ekaterina has featured in some of the leading publications such as Vanity Fair, Country Living, Vogue, Elle, New York Times and others.

Websites:

CBD Life Mag

Reddit

Twitter

Medium

Pinterest

LinkedIn

YouTube

Contact:

info@cbdlifemag.com